Understanding Noise Levels in RTX 4090 Laptops

Noise levels in laptops are primarily caused by the cooling system, particularly the fans. When the GPU and CPU operate at high loads, they generate significant heat. To maintain optimal temperatures, the cooling fans ramp up, producing more noise.

Noise During Heavy Gaming

During heavy gaming sessions, RTX 4090 laptops often reach high GPU utilization. Users report that fans can become quite loud, sometimes reaching over 50 decibels, which is comparable to a normal conversation. This noise can be distracting, especially in quiet environments.

Manufacturers attempt to balance cooling efficiency and noise by implementing various fan control algorithms. Some laptops feature software that allows users to adjust fan profiles, reducing noise at the expense of higher temperatures.

Noise During Rendering Tasks

Rendering tasks, such as 3D modeling or video editing, also push the RTX 4090 to its limits. During these processes, noise levels tend to be similar to gaming, with fans operating at high speeds. Prolonged rendering can lead to sustained noise, which may cause fatigue or discomfort.

Some users have reported that rendering can cause the fans to run at maximum speed continuously, leading to noise levels exceeding 60 decibels in some cases. This level of noise can be disruptive in shared or quiet workspaces.

Factors Affecting Noise Levels

  • Thermal Design: Better cooling solutions reduce fan speed and noise.
  • Fan Control Settings: Custom profiles can lower noise but may increase temperatures.
  • Ambient Temperature: Higher room temperatures can cause fans to work harder, increasing noise.
  • Workload Intensity: More demanding tasks generate more heat, leading to louder fans.

Tips to Manage Noise Levels

  • Use Quiet Mode: Many laptops offer a quiet or balanced mode in their software settings.
  • Improve Ventilation: Ensure proper airflow around the laptop to aid cooling and reduce fan speed.
  • Undervolting: Some users undervolt their GPU to reduce heat output, which can lower fan noise.
  • External Cooling: Using a cooling pad can help dissipate heat more effectively.
